Volleyball Splits Stinger Classic Finale

SUPERIOR, Wis. – On the second and final day of the Subway Stinger Classic, the Yellowjacket volleyball team suffered a three-set loss to UW-River Falls before rebounding nicely, defeating Augsburg 3-1 on Saturday.
 
Match One Notes
  • UWRF took an early 5-1 lead before Kate Jamtgaard (Grand Rapids, Minn./Grand Rapids) and Makenna Hohbein (Holdingford, Minn./Holdingford) logged kills for Superior. Melissa Hoff (Holmen, Wis./Holmen) logged a solo block as well, but the Falcons would maintain a small margin of lead throughout the set.
  • At 16-11, the 'Jackets caught up with kills from Kyndra Peterson (Mounds View, Minn./Irondale) and a handful of Falcon errors, but a pair of rallies gave UW-River Falls a 25-17 victory.
  • UWS led 6-2 in the second set after points from Jamtgaard and Hohbein, but a pair of five-point rallies boosted the Falcons in front. Despite kills from Sydney Smith (Milltown, Wis./Unity), Hoff and Peterson, the Falcons emerged with a 25-19 win in set two.
  • In the third, the 'Jackets traded points with the Falcons early on until a five-point rally benefitted Superior, including kills from Hoff and Peterson and a service ace from Hohbein. At 22-19, UWRF rallied and came home with a 25-23 set victory.
  • Jamtgaard led the offensive charge with seven kills, followed by Hohbein and Peterson's five apiece.
  • Carlie Lohman (South Range, Wis./Superior) dished 13 assists, while Savanna Hering (Superior, Wis./Superior) logged 17 digs.
 
Match Two Notes
  • UW-Superior began the opening set with the Auggies on the right foot, leading by 9-4. Augsburg responded with a pair of kills and received some help from Yellowjacket errors, coming within one at 12-11.
  • In a back-and-forth battle for the lead throughout the remainder of the set, Taylor Tollefson (Pine City, Minn./Pine City), alongside Peterson and Hoff, spearheaded the Yellowjackets to a 27-25 win in the opener.
  • The 'Jackets and Auggies volleyed the momentum early until six consecutive points came for the Yellowjackets, leading 13-7. A pair of smaller rallies helped produce the momentum needed to win the second 25-15.
  • Augsburg responded in the third. After the Yellowjackets saw production from Tollefson, Hohbein and Smith to lead 20-11, the Auggies utilized a combination of kills and Yellowjacket attack errors to shift the momentum drastically, winning the third 25-23.
  • The fourth was heavily contested as both teams battled for the early advantage. Superior garnered a lead of three points at 16-13, and from there used a four-point rally to end the match with a 25-22 win.
  • Tollefson led the Yellowjackets with 16 kills, followed by Hohbein's 11 and Peterson's eight.
  • Hohbein led with 21 digs while Hering had 20. Lohman led with 22 assists while Alayna Schultz (Atwater, Minn./Atwater-Cosmos-Grove City) finished her match with 18.
 
The Yellowjackets (8-2) will now shift their focus to the Upper Midwest Athletic Conference (UMAC), hosting Northwestern on Friday. The opening serve is set for 7 p.m. inside Mertz Mortorelli Gym.
